Ron Artest showed up for his NBA Finals Game 7 postgame press conference buzzed on champagne and the thrill of being a world champion. He was surrounded by his family as he offered long, introspective and entertaining answers that didn’t necessarily match the questions the reporters asked. It was beautiful. Ron spoke about his psychiatrist again and told of Phil Jackson’s ability to mentally communicate with his players. Kobe had the best line in his postgame press conference when he said “I got one more than Shaq” but Ron-Ron had the best overall interview. He was so excited that he didn’t know what to do with himself and rightfully so. He overcame the drama of the Palace brawl and did the one thing Allen Iverson, Michael Vick and Terrell Owens couldn’t: He won the hood a championship.
